What to look for when choosing a company that hires VAs 

  • Transparency

Make sure the company you hire is fully transparent and will give you no problems or future hidden fees.

  • Safety 

Make sure you hire a company with US legal standing, and that can also be your employer of record in any LATAM country so that you have peace of mind when it comes to compliance.

  • Employee care 

Make sure they pay employees fair salaries and offer all VAs health, dental, and life insurance. This will create happy, loyal workers and therefore increase your employee retention rate.


Other factors to take into consideration:

  • Cheap labor

Is the labor in the country you’re hiring so cheap to the point that they’re not receiving fair wages? Or maybe they’re working for multiple people!

  • Cultural barriers

A person overseas might not be too familiar with the culture in the US, but a person across the border probably will be.

  • Time zone

Virtual assistants located overseas are usually working the opposite schedule as you or they’re working their nights and it’s showing in their performance.

Types of VAs

Initially, VAs were thought of as people who worked remotely and would only help with small and simple tasks. This definition has outgrown itself now that technology is rapidly advancing, and the pandemic is isolating us more and more. We have adapted rapidly to this new way of working from home and now see it as normal for almost any job we can think of.

Some of the positions VAs have been carrying out range from entry level admin and executive assistants, to marketing specialists, to more skilled and specialized roles, like web developers.

How to hire a VA

First, you must be ready and have some acknowledgment of your challenges, goals, and plans. Once you have that, you’re ready for the next steps.

  1. Have a clear definition of what you want your VA to do for you. As we mentioned, the possibilities are endless, but clearly outlining your pain points is very important in order to find the right VA.
  2. Have a budget. Depending on the VA you want and the roles you want them to carry out, the price range can vary. Having a clear budget in mind can help you navigate the waters.
  3. Find a VA company that best suits your needs. Compare VA websites that offer what you want, what you need, and what you aspire and let the VA company help you with the rest. Yes, it’s that easy.
